Ukraine won't join Saudi talks - Podoliak

Ukraine will not have representatives to represent it in the negotiations with the participation of the United States and Russia in Saudi Arabia.

Axar.az reports that this was stated by the Advisor to the Head of the Presidential Administration of Ukraine, Mykhailo Podoliak.

"President Zelensky said that there is no spokesperson to represent Ukraine in Saudi Arabia. There is nothing to discuss at the negotiating table today. Russia is not ready for negotiations," - said M. Podoliak.

According to Podoliak, negotiations are necessary for Russia for three reasons:

"First, an operational pause to improve the army, second, increasing ultimatum demands, and third, speculation on sanctions."
